We will pass by Riga Cathedral (Riga Dome), one of the city's symbols. Riga Cathedral is the seat of the Archbishop of Latvia Evangelical Lutheran Church and a significant symbol of the spiritual life of Latvia.
Riga Town Hall Square is also one of the city's symbols and a place that tourists usually visit. The famous House of the Blackheads will also come into view.
Konventa Sēta is one of the oldest quarters of the city, consisting of several buildings. It is definitely worth visiting later and exploring at a leisurely pace.
The leisurely ride will also allow you to enjoy the view of the Freedom Monument and the Laima Clock.
We will experience Livu Square, always bustling and rich with restaurants. Eight streets converge here.
